Ken Kutaragi has a Nintendo PlayStation prototype safely tucked away

The father of PlayStation Ken Kutaragi revealed to a fan that he has his own Nintendo PlayStation prototype safely tucked away. The news was shared by Tokyo Retro Gamer reporter Julian Domanski via his X account. Domanski met up with Mr. Kutaragi and snapped some photos of the highly-sought-after device and believes that the last one sold at auction for around $300,000.
